Abstract:
Integrated Sensing and Communications (ISAC) has emerged as a key enabling paradigm for future wireless systems, particularly within Non-Terrestrial Network (NTN) architectures. This work reviews ISAC system designs for Low Earth Orbit (LEO) satellites, High-Altitude Platform Systems (HAPS), and Unmanned Aerial Vehicle (UAV)-based platforms, with emphasis on joint waveform design, resource sharing, and interference management. Existing approaches are analyzed in terms of the fundamental trade-offs between sensing accuracy and communication performance. Moreover, NTN-specific challenges, including high mobility, Doppler effects, propagation delay, and channel uncertainty, are examined with respect to their impact on ISAC system design. The study aims to provide a structured overview of current ISAC over NTN solutions and to identify potential research directions relevant to future thesis work.
